Subject: DR drill — Prosewright linter failover

Team: tonight's drill takes the Prosewright documentation linter primary offline at 02:00. On-call: confirm the Hollowpine replica picks up lint jobs within five minutes. If the replica stalls, restart via the recovery console, not the dashboard. Console access requires unlocking the drill credentials bundle. The recovery passphrase for that bundle is below.

unlock words, yawig-kagef: gordor-holvan-ulaael-pramir-ulaiel-tamdor

From: R. Calloway  To: incoming director
For distribution to the finance team.

Project Ironvale (warehouse automation rollout) is fourteen weeks late. Causes: supplier delays at Kestwick, integration failures in phase two testing, and a paused capital release in Q1. Spend to date: 61% of approved budget. Remaining contingency is thin. Recommend freezing scope, renegotiating the Kestwick delivery schedule, and re-baselining before any further drawdown. Finance should treat current forecasts as stale. The forward plan is set out below.

confidential, kagep-kahof: Druokax Systems plans to lower the Ulaath list price by 53 percent in March.

Checklist item — Queue replacement (Mossfen 2.0). Verify the homegrown Tangle queue is fully drained before cutover to the new broker, and that the shim translating legacy job payloads is enabled. Reviewer must confirm no dual-enqueue paths remain in the worker config. The cutover build carries the token below.

session token of bahip-hawep = htk4_b0c1